Biographical Notes

Degree in History, Lisbon University (Faculty of Arts and Humanities - 1980)
Master in History of Cultural and Political History/History of Culture (FCSH-UNL - 1986)
PhD Contemporary History, University of Madeira, Department of Modern Languages & Literatures (1998)
Aggregation, University of Madeira, Faculty of Social Sciences, Department of Management and Economy (2007)
The research focuses the study of the evolution of Madeira global business, in particular the Madeira wine industry and embroidery industries, and the role played by the government in that process. The publications are in the field of business history in journals such as Business History, or in the field of history of institutions in journals like Continuity and Change, and Análise Social; as well as books published by Routledge, Berhghahn, and Instituto de Ciencias Sociais, Lisbon.
